Overview of Samsung Galaxy Watch Ultra

The Samsung Galaxy Watch Ultra represents a significant leap in smartwatch technology, combining state-of-the-art design with cutting-edge features. Planned for release in July 2024, this exceptional device is designed for tech enthusiasts who seek performance, durability, and functionality within a single wearable.

Design and Build Quality

Incorporating a sturdy and sophisticated design, the Galaxy Watch Ultra features dimensions of 47.4 x 47.4 x 12.1 mm and weighs 60.5 grams. The watch is crafted using high-quality materials, including a front made of sapphire crystal, a ceramic/sapphire crystal back, and a Grade 4 titanium frame. The use of these materials not only ensures aesthetic elegance but also offers enhanced durability, making the watch resistant to daily wear and tear. Available in Titanium Silver, Titanium Gray, and Titanium White, the watch can complement a wide variety of personal styles.

Display Features

The Galaxy Watch Ultra boasts an impressive 1.5-inch Super AMOLED display with a resolution of 480 x 480 pixels, offering around 327 ppi pixel density. The display, protected by sapphire crystal glass, ensures vivid colors and deep contrasts that make the watch face easily viewable even in bright sunlight. Such a high-resolution screen ensures that information is sharp and clear, enhancing the user experience for reading notifications or accessing apps.

Performance and Hardware

Under the hood, the Galaxy Watch Ultra is powered by the Exynos W1000 chipset, built on a 3 nm process, promising efficient power consumption and robust performance. The Penta-core CPU, coupled with the Mali-G68 GPU, ensures smooth operation and high responsiveness for all the watch's features. With 2GB of RAM and 32GB of internal storage, the watch can handle multiple applications simultaneously and store a considerable amount of data locally, although it lacks an expandable card slot.

Battery Life and Charging

Equipped with a 590 mAh Li-Ion battery, the Galaxy Watch Ultra is designed to last throughout the day, even under heavy usage. Its 10W wireless charging capability, compliant with the Qi standard, means the watch can be conveniently recharged without the hassle of cables, simply by placing it on a compatible charging pad.

Connectivity and Sensors

In terms of connectivity, the Galaxy Watch Ultra supports a variety of wireless technologies. It includes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ac for internet connectivity, Bluetooth 5.4 for seamless device pairing, and NFC for contactless payments. For positioning, the watch integrates GPS (L1+L5), GLONASS, GALILEO, and BDS, ensuring accurate location tracking for outdoor activities. Although the watch does not feature a USB port, it incorporates an eSIM, allowing for standalone voice and data services on LTE networks.

Health and Fitness Tracking

The Galaxy Watch Ultra is equipped with an array of sensors designed to monitor and improve your health and fitness. It includes an accelerometer, gyroscope, and heart rate monitor to track activities and physiological metrics. Its unique features also include an always-on altimeter and barometer, compass, SpO2 sensor for blood oxygen levels, and VO2max measurement for cardio fitness. Additionally, sensors for body and water temperature provide comprehensive data collection for various health insights.

Network
Technology GSM / HSPA / LTE
2G bands G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bands H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1700(AWS) / 1900 / 2100
4G bands LTE
Speed HSPA, LTE
Launch
Announced 2024, July 10
Status Coming soon. Exp. release 2024, July
Body
Dimensions 47.4 x 47.4 x 12.1 mm (1.87 x 1.87 x 0.48 in)
Weight 60.5 g (2.15 oz)
Build Sapphire crystal front, ceramic/sapphire crystal back, titanium frame (grade 4)
SIM eSIM
Display
Type Super AMOLED
Size 1.5 inches
Resolution 480 x 480 pixels (~327 ppi density)
Protection Sapphire crystal glass
Platform
OS Android Wear OS 5, One UI Watch 6
Chipset Exynos W1000 (3 nm)
CPU Penta-core
GPU Mali-G68
Memory
Card slot No
Internal 32GB 2GB RAM
Camera
Sound
Loudspeaker Yes
3.5mm jack No
Comms
WLAN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band
Bluetooth 5.4, A2DP, LE
Positioning GPS (L1+L5), G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S
NFC Yes
Radio No
USB No
Features
Sensors Accelerometer, gyro, heart rate, barometer, always-on altimeter, compass, SpO2, VO2max, temperature (body), temperature (water)
Battery
Type Li-Ion 590 mAh, non-removable
Charging 10W wireless (Qi)
Misc
Colors Titanium Sliver, Titanium Gray, Titanium White
Models SM-L705F, SM-L705N, SM-L705U
